Explanation:

Step1: Identify parts and whole

The individual white - colored parts of the airplane on the left represent the reactants in a chemical reaction. The assembled blue airplane on the right represents the product.

Step2: Apply law of conservation of mass

The law states that mass is conserved. Here, the sum of the masses of the individual parts (reactants) is equal to the mass of the assembled airplane (product), just as in a chemical reaction where the mass of reactants equals the mass of products.
